in the USANorth Idaho College is a small public college offering numerous disciplines along with nursing majors and located in
Coeur dAlene,
Idaho. The school was opened in 1933 and is presently offering certificates and associate's degrees in 2 nursing programs.
North Idaho College is inexpensive - tuition is about $10,000 per year. If you are looking for a cheaper alternative, check
Affordable Colleges in Idaho listing.
According to recent data analysis, North Idaho College area is relatively safe: the college is reported to have
a fair rating for on-campus safety.
